Understanding Medium Voltage Electric Motors
Medium voltage electric motors generally refer to motors operating between 1 kV and 35 kV. They are essential for numerous applications in industries such as oil and gas, water treatment, and manufacturing because of their ability to drive high-performance equipment. Knowing the technical specifications and the context in which these motors will be used is crucial before entering into a relationship with any supplier.

Practical Tips for Choosing the Right Supplier
- Assess Capabilities: Review the technical specifications and capabilities of the motors they supply.
- Check Certifications: Ensure the supplier is certified and adheres to industry standards like ISO9001 for quality management.
- Evaluate Service Levels: Ask about post-sale services, including maintenance support and spare parts availability.
- Seek References: Contact existing customers to gain insights into their experiences and satisfaction levels.
